156. A sample weighing 0.4566 g containing potassium bromide and indifferent impurities was dissolved in a 100.0 ml volumetric flask. To 15.00 ml of the resulting solution, 20.00 ml of silver nitrate solution was added, C(AgNO3) = 0.05036 mol/l. The unreacted silver ions were titrated with 10.98 ml of ammonium thiocyanate solution with a concentration of 0.05046 mol/l. Calculate the mass fraction of potassium bromide in the sample.
